    Armo wrote:all the parts are new, so it should not be broken.
    090911-12558-01.dmp 09.09.2011 17:52:18 MEMORY_MANAGEMENT 0x0000001a ntoskrnl.exe ntoskrnl.exe+80640


    New parts don't mean anything. Parts can come faulty straight from the manufacturer.

    That code is leading to the RAM. You probably have a bad RAM module and need to get a new one. Download this:

    http://hcidesign.com/memtest/

    and run it (set it to "all unused RAM") for a few hours and see if it comes up with any errors. If it does, your RAM is bad.
